— This system makes no distinction between<br />

limited traffic control and total control<br />

(blockage). It may show a detoured route<br />

even if the road is usable.<br />

— Even if the freeway preference is set to OFF,<br />

the route may be set on them. To avoid this,<br />

set a waypoint on another road type and request<br />

calculation.<br />

— Even if the preference is set to OFF for a<br />

ferry line, the route may be set on it. To<br />

avoid this, set a waypoint on a road and request<br />

calculation.<br />

ABOUT THE DISPLAY ERROR<br />

The following cases may affect the display accuracy<br />

of the vehicle’s position or travel direction.<br />

The accuracy will return to normal if the<br />

driving conditions return to normal.<br />

— When there is a similar road nearby.<br />

— When the vehicle is traveling on a long<br />

stretch of straight road or series of curves<br />

with a large radius.<br />

— When the vehicle is traveling in an area with<br />

a grid road system.<br />

— When the vehicle is making consecutive S<br />

curves.<br />

— When the vehicle is at a large Y-shaped<br />

junction.<br />

— When the vehicle is on a loop bridge.<br />

— When the vehicle is on a snow-covered or<br />

unpaved road.<br />

— When the vehicle has made several consecutive<br />

turns or traveled zigzag.<br />

— When the vehicle is rotated on a parking lot<br />

turntable while the ignition switch is OFF .<br />

— Immediately after the vehicle is driven out<br />

of a parking garage or underground parking<br />

lot.<br />

— When the vehicle has different sizes of tires<br />

or tire chains.<br />

— When the vehicle is moved immediately after<br />

the engine is started.<br />
